Key Responsibilities

The Speech-Language Pathologist evaluates and provides skilled therapy to patients in home settings, including those with language, motor speech, and cognitive communication impairments. They work with patients recovering from strokes or managing progressive conditions like Parkinson's disease and dementia.

Requirements

Candidates must be currently licensed as an SLP in the state of employment and possess a valid driver's license with automobile liability insurance. The role requires dependable transportation and the ability to drive in various weather conditions.
